Post-production, automatic
The polish that normally takes hours, applied the moment you stop recording.
Superscreen tracks your cursor and pushes in on the action. Every click framed, zero keyframes.
Shaky pointer movement becomes a confident glide, with a subtle pulse on every click.
Gradients, wallpapers, padding, and continuous-corner rounding, composed automatically.
Webcam as a bubble, full-screen, or split. Reshape, mirror, and restyle, all after the take.
Word-level subtitles transcribed locally, so nothing leaves your Mac. Fully styleable.
Hardware H.264 via VideoToolbox. What you see in preview is exactly what the file becomes.
The workflow
Drag a region, grab a window, or take the full screen, with mic, system audio, and camera in one pass.
Auto-zoom and backgrounds land instantly. Adjust anything in a live, real-time editor.
Render a pixel-perfect 4K MP4, frame-for-frame identical to the preview you watched.
